What Is Stem Cell Therapy?
Stem cell therapy is a medical treatment that uses stem cells—distinctive cells capable of creating into many various cell types—to repair, replace, or regenerate damaged tissues within the body. These cells act as the building blocks of life and have the ability to transform into specialised cells corresponding to muscle, nerve, or blood cells.
The therapy has gained attention because it provides potential solutions for chronic ailments, injuries, and age-related conditions that traditional treatments can’t absolutely address.
Recent Breakthroughs in Stem Cell Research
The past few years have seen speedy advancements that are pushing stem cell therapy forward:
1. Regeneration of Heart Tissue
Cardiovascular diseases remain one of many leading causes of demise worldwide. Researchers have made progress using stem cells to regenerate damaged heart tissue after a heart attack. Early clinical trials show that stem cells might assist restore heart function by repairing scarred tissue and improving blood flow.
2. Treatment of Neurological Disorders
Neurological conditions akin to Parkinson’s illness, multiple sclerosis, and spinal cord accidents are notoriously troublesome to treat. Latest research have demonstrated that stem cells can replace damaged nerve cells, reduce inflammation, and stimulate repair in the central nervous system. Patients with spinal cord accidents have even regained partial mobility after stem cell-based mostly treatments.
3. Advances in Diabetes Therapy
Type 1 diabetes is caused by the destruction of insulin-producing cells within the pancreas. Stem cell researchers at the moment are developing strategies to generate new insulin-producing beta cells. Early trials have shown promise in restoring natural insulin production, providing hope for a long-term solution to diabetes management.
4. Use of Induced Pluripotent Stem Cells (iPSCs)
Some of the significant breakthroughs has been the development of induced pluripotent stem cells. These are adult cells reprogrammed to behave like embryonic stem cells, eliminating ethical considerations while opening new possibilities for personalized treatments. iPSCs could be derived from a patient’s own cells, reducing the risk of rejection in therapy.
5. Progress in Cancer Treatment
Stem cell therapy can be being explored in oncology. Researchers are experimenting with using stem cells to deliver targeted therapies directly to tumors. This approach could improve the effectiveness of cancer treatment while minimizing side effects from chemotherapy and radiation.

Challenges and Ethical Considerations
Despite its promise, stem cell therapy is not without challenges. Many treatments are still within the experimental stage and require more clinical trials to prove long-term safety and effectiveness. Regulatory approval is also strict, which slows down widespread adoption. Ethical debates continue, particularly regarding embryonic stem cell research, although the rise of iPSCs has helped address some concerns.
